Understanding the private equity deal process is key to succeeding in interviews. Firms want to see that you understand the full life cycle of a deal—from sourcing to exit—and what happens at each stage. This blog outlines the steps in a typical PE deal process and how to speak to them in interviews.
Areas to focus on when outlining the PE deal process include;
- Deal Sourcing: Origination through banker relationships, proprietary outreach, or internal research.
- Initial Screening: Quick assessment of market, financials, and strategic fit.
- Due Diligence: Deep dive into financials, legal, tax, operations, and commercial aspects.
- Investment Committee: Pitching the deal internally for approval.
- Execution: Finalising terms, negotiating with sellers, and closing.
- Portfolio Management: Ongoing oversight, reporting, and value creation.
- Exit: Via sale, IPO, or recapitalisation.
